MySql教程

Mysql之5.7.26下载、安装、windows命令行之成功登陆及密码修改

本文主要是介绍Mysql之5.7.26下载、安装、windows命令行之成功登陆及密码修改,对大家解决编程问题具有一定的参考价值,需要的程序猿们随着小编来一起学习吧!

Mysql之5.7.26下载、安装、windows命令行之成功登陆及密码修改

Mysql的下载

喜欢的朋友请点亮一下菜鸟的编程之路。

mysql官网各种版本下载地址
在这里插入图片描述然后我们选择5.7.26 Windows操作系统 64位
在这里插入图片描述

到这里我们下载步骤完成后,解压好
我这里解压之后的路径为:D:\4\mysql-5.7.26-winx64

Mysql安装

当我们进入解压后的文件夹mysql-5.7.26-winx64请按以下操作:

  1. 浏览以下子文件

新解压好的文件是没有data文件夹和my.ini文件;

在这里插入图片描述

  1. 配置my.ini

现在我们先在mysql-5.7.26-winx64下新建一个记事本,然后将代码片粘贴进去, 注意自己的路径,粘贴之后重命名记事本my.ini(至于看不到文件后缀?后缀如何更改?······请看自己文件上方工具栏) ;

[mysqld]
# 设置3306端口
port=3306
# 设置mysql的安装目录
basedir=D:\4\mysql-5.7.26-winx64
# 设置mysql数据库的数据的存放目录
datadir=D:\4\mysql-5.7.26-winx64\Data
# 允许最大连接数
max_connections=200
# 允许连接失败的次数。这是为了防止有人从该主机试图攻击数据库系统
max_connect_errors=10
# 服务端使用的字符集默认为UTF8
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
# 默认使用“mysql_native_password”插件认证
default_authentication_plugin=mysql_native_password
[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8
[client]
# 设置mysql客户端连接服务端时默认使用的端口
port=3306
default-character-set=utf8
  1. 环境配置
    弹出运行窗口快捷键:windows+R
    执行命令sysdm.cpl在这里插入图片描述
    在这里插入图片描述
    在这里插入图片描述变量名:MYSQL_HOME 变量值:D:\4\mysql-5.7.26-winx64
    在这里插入图片描述
    %MYSQL_HOME%\bin
    最后别忘记点确定、确定、确定

  2. 安装Mysql服务

键入cmd命令,以管理员身份打开cmd窗口后,mysql文件的bin目录下,执行mysqld install命令(默认安装mysql)
在这里插入图片描述

mysqld install
  1. 初始化data目录
    继续黑窗口在bin目录下执行mysqld --initialize命令,自动生成Data目录
mysqld --initialize

此时可以看一下自己的mysql-5.7.26-winx64目录下的
在这里插入图片描述

  1. 启动mysql;

继续黑窗口在bin目录下执行命令

net start mysql

修改密码

  1. 回到文件夹下目录进行操作:

在my.ini文件(MySQL的配置文件)的[mysqld]下加一行

skip-grant-tables  //跳过权限验证不需要用户名和密码可以直接登陆数据库
  1. 回到黑窗口操作:

修改配置文件后重启服务:
停止服务:net stop mysql
重启服务 net start mysql

黑窗口········mysql-5.7.26-winx64>mysql -u root -p//执行命令
登录到mysql服务器

  1. 前面是无密码登陆的处理,接下来是使用密码登陆:

(我没有使用1.2两步,直接采用的临时密码登陆)
Enter password:
(临时密码如下:)
在这里插入图片描述
进入数据库后键入如下代码 ,即修改用户root密码为root

update mysql.user set authentication_string=password("root") where user="root"

然后quit退出

再重新进入黑窗口登陆即可。

然后大家再用navicat连接即可

不好意思,写的很啰嗦,偏向咱这种初级使用者。

这篇关于Mysql之5.7.26下载、安装、windows命令行之成功登陆及密码修改的文章就介绍到这儿,希望我们推荐的文章对大家有所帮助,也希望大家多多支持为之网!